Are there any specialized HVAC or Refrigeration training programs accessible to Universal City residents?
Yes, residents have access to specialized training through The Refrigeration School, which offers programs in HVAC Technology and Refrigeration. These programs are designed to prepare students for in-demand careers as HVACR technicians, focusing on installation, maintenance, and repair of commercial and residential systems, which is crucial in Texas's climate.

Which certifications should I pursue through a Universal City-area trade school to become a licensed electrician or plumber in Texas?
To become a licensed tradesperson in Texas, you must complete an apprenticeship and pass a state exam. Programs in Electrical Technology or Plumbing at schools like St. Philip's College provide the foundational technical training required. These programs help you gain the knowledge needed to become an apprentice and eventually a journeyman, covering the National Electrical Code, pipe systems, and state-specific regulations.
